Php jquery div标记在post请求后未关闭,并且警报在chrome浏览器中不工作
关于jquery,我有几个问题 这是我的密码Php jquery div标记在post请求后未关闭,并且警报在chrome浏览器中不工作,php,jquery,Php,Jquery,关于jquery,我有几个问题 这是我的密码 <?php $date=$_POST["user"]; require_once("test1.php"); function createReportTable($result, $title){ }?> <html> <head> <script type="text/javascript" src="http://
<?php $date=$_POST["user"]; require_once("test1.php");
function createReportTable($result, $title){ }?>
<html>
<head>
<script type="text/javascript" src="http://code.jquery.com/jquery-1.4.3.min.js" ></script>
<script type="text/javascript">
$(document).ready(function() {
alert("hi");
$('.show_hide').hide();
$('.addperm').submit(function(){
var query = $('#user').val();
$.post("test.php", query, function(response){
alert(response);
}); }); $('.show_hide').show(); });
</script>
</head>
<body>
<form action= 'test.php' class = 'addperm' method='post'>
<input type='text' name='user' id='user' /><br />
<input type='submit' value='Add' id="add">
</form>
<div id="wrapper" class="show_hide">
<div id="center">
<div>
<?php createReportTable(getReport($date), "xyz"); ?>
</div>
</div> </div>
$(文档).ready(函数(){
警报(“hi”);
$('.show_hide').hide();
$('.addperm').submit(函数(){
var query=$('#user').val();
$.post(“test.php”、查询、函数(响应){
警报(响应);
});});$('.show_hide').show();});
下面是我的问题
1) 我试图使用警报功能,但它在chrome中不起作用。firefox它工作得很好。为什么会这样?
2) 我试图隐藏和取消隐藏div标签,但它在chrome中似乎根本不起作用,但在firefox中,它隐藏了div标签,但没有再次显示它
我认为div标签没有再次显示的原因是在$post页面刷新之后,因此无法工作。如果这是问题所在,我该如何解决?如果这不是问题,那么问题可能是什么。为什么chrome浏览器不工作
如果我不关心div标记,那么代码工作得很好,并在所有浏览器中提供所需的输出
任何帮助都将不胜感激直接复制此代码并在Chrome中进行测试。似乎工作得很好(出现了警报框)。我正在使用LinuxMint,这是一个问题吗@AlexMorriseWell,“test1.php”中的任何内容都可能是一个问题。在test1.php中有一个函数getReport(),它从数据库中获取数据。我使用PDO从数据库中获取数据。没有别的了@Alex Morrise